Harissa Chicken and Vegetable Tray Bake
Ingredients
- 1 tbsp Olive Oil
- 2 Chicken Breasts
- 2 tbsp Harissa Paste
- Handful of Cherry Tomatoes
- 1 Baking Potato (cut into cubes)
- 1 Broccoli (cut into florets)
- 1 Red Onion (cut into quarters)
Directions
- Preheat your oven to 200°C (180°C Fan)
- Peel and cut the potato into cubes, cut the broccoli into florets, peel and quarter the onion and pop into a large bowl.
- Add the tomatoes, chicken breast and two tablespoons of the harissa paste. Drizzle with oil and season with salt and pepper then mix well until the chicken, potato and vegetables are all coated.
- Arrange everything on a baking tray and bake in the oven for 20-30 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through.
